Overview

The Complete Guitar Chords Handbook Everything You Need to Learn, Practice, and Master Guitar ChordsThe Complete Guitar Chords Handbook is a comprehensive, practical, and beginner-friendly guide designed for anyone who wants to develop confidence in playing guitar chords with clarity and skill. Whether you are picking up a guitar for the very first time or looking to strengthen your chord knowledge and playing technique, this handbook provides a structured and easy-to-follow approach to learning guitar in a simple and enjoyable way. This book is not just a collection of chord diagrams-it is a complete learning resource focused on building strong musical foundations, improving finger coordination, strengthening rhythm, and helping players transition smoothly between chords. Drawing from essential music principles, practical exercises, and real-world playing techniques, this handbook offers a balanced approach to learning guitar chords with patience, consistency, and confidence. Inside, You'll Discover: Understanding Guitar BasicsA clear introduction to the parts of the guitar, string names, tuning methods, posture, and hand positioning. Learn how the guitar works and why proper technique is important for long-term progress and comfortable playing. Essential Beginner ChordsStep-by-step guidance on major, minor, seventh, and power chords commonly used in popular music styles. Learn how to position your fingers correctly, avoid buzzing strings, and develop clean chord tones. Chord Transition TechniquesPractical exercises designed to improve speed and smoothness when changing between chords. Discover techniques that help beginners reduce finger strain and build muscle memory naturally over time. Strumming Patterns and RhythmEasy-to-follow lessons on rhythm, timing, and strumming patterns. Understand how rhythm brings chords to life and how consistent practice can improve overall musical confidence. Barre Chords and Advanced ShapesA beginner-friendly introduction to barre chords and movable chord forms. Learn how these shapes expand your ability to play songs in different keys across the fretboard. Finger Strength and Practice ExercisesSimple daily exercises to improve finger flexibility, coordination, endurance, and hand control. These routines are designed to help players practice effectively without feeling overwhelmed. Reading Chord Charts and DiagramsClear explanations of chord charts, tablature, fretboard symbols, and finger placement guides. Gain confidence in reading instructional material and applying it during practice sessions. Common Mistakes and Troubleshooting TipsHelpful advice for avoiding common beginner problems such as muted strings, sore fingers, poor timing, and inconsistent chord transitions. Learn practical solutions that encourage steady improvement. Playing Songs with ConfidenceGuidance on applying chords to real songs, building rhythm consistency, and practicing musical flow. Learn how combining chords and rhythm patterns can help you start playing complete songs more naturally. Long-Term Guitar GrowthEncouragement and strategies for continued improvement, including practice planning, ear training, chord progressions, and musical creativity. This section helps readers stay motivated while building lasting guitar skills. A Simple and Encouraging Learning ApproachThis handbook promotes steady growth, patience, and consistent practice, encouraging readers to enjoy the learning process while building practical guitar-playing skills. Whether your goal is to play for personal enjoyment, songwriting, worship, performance, or creative expression, The Complete Guitar Chords Handbook provides the clear guidance and foundational knowledge needed to practice, improve, and master guitar chords with confidence.
